JOB DESCRIPTION:
The Caregiver/CNA provides specifically defined, non-skilled health care services under the supervision of a Registered Nurse to enable the client to remain in the home. The Caregiver/CNA is a non-licensed health care employee who provides personal care and light housekeeping services in the home setting of clients and families who are unable to perform these activities independently. The Caregiver/CNA conforms to all agency policies and procedures including providing care in compliance with the agency Bill of Rights, observing client and family confidentiality, and adherence to agency dress code.

ROUTINE DUTIES- PERSONAL CARE SERVICES:
1. Bathing, assistance with dressing, nail and skin care, back care, foot care, shampoo and oral hygiene.
2. Assistance with ambulation, transfers, range of motion exercise, safe use of equipment and assistive devices, (walker, crutches, cane) change of position.
3. Assistance with toileting; use of bedpan, commode, or urinal; incontinent care.

HOUSEHOLD MANAGEMENT:
1. Light Housekeeping- including changing of bed linens, vacuuming, sweeping, dusting of client’s environment, emptying client’s wastebaskets and garbage. Refrigerators are defrosted, when necessary, if client or caretaker is unable to do so. Cleaning of the bathroom includes bathtub, sink, and toilet. The floor should be vacuumed and mopped if it becomes wet. Cleaning of kitchen includes washing dishes, counter tops and the floor.
2. Personal laundry- the laundry that is essential to client’s health care. Laundry for any family members or others in the same home is not the responsibility of caregiver.
3. Grocery shopping.
